What is a Cot Bed?
In the beginning look, a cot bed looks really similar to a basic baby cot. Nevertheless, the crucial distinction depends on its durability. While a conventional cot is typically developed for children approximately roughly 18 months to 2 years old, a cot bed is larger and cleverly designed to change into a toddler bed.
By simply eliminating the side panels and splitting or decreasing completion panels, a cot bed can accommodate a growing kid as much as the age of 4, and in some cases even 5, depending on the child's height and the particular design.

2. Bed Mattress Size and Quality
Unlike basic cots, cot beds normally measure 140 x 70 cm. When purchasing a bed mattress, ensure it fits comfortably without any spaces bigger than 3cm between the bed mattress and the sides of the bed. It ought to be firm, breathable, and water resistant.

4. Teething Rails
Numerous modern cot beds include plastic teething strips along the top edges of the side panels. These protect your baby's developing teeth and gums and prevent the wood finish from getting chewed up.

Q2: Are standard cot sheets compatible with cot bed mattresses?
A: No. Since cot beds are bigger (usually 140 x 70 cm) than standard cots (120 x 60 cm), you will require to buy cot-bed-specific fitted sheets and bedding.
Q3: When should I decrease the mattress base?
A: You must decrease the bed mattress base as quickly as your baby reaches developmental turning points. Move it down from the highest setting when your baby can roll over or sit unaided, and drop it to the most affordable setting the moment they start attempting to pull themselves as much as stand.
Q4: Is it challenging to transform a cot bed into a toddler bed?
A: Generally, no. The majority of makers design cot beds to be quickly converted utilizing an Allen key (typically provided). The process generally takes between 15 to 30 minutes.
